US Launches Third Wave of Strikes on Iranian Military Targets; Iran Claims Retaliatory Attacks on Gulf Infrastructure
Summary
The United States has escalated direct military engagement by launching a third round of strikes against 149 military targets within Iran. Iran has responded by claiming successful attacks on US military infrastructure across multiple Gulf states, indicating a significant escalation in direct state-on-state conflict and potential regional expansion.
